Types of support available
In Conrad, a variety of support options are available to those experiencing domestic violence:
- Lawyers: Legal professionals can help you understand your rights and guide you through the legal process.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als can provide counseling and support to help you cope with the emotional impact of domestic violence.
- Shelters: Safe spaces are available for those needing to escape an abusive environment.
- Hotlines: Confidential support is just a phone call away for immediate assistance and guidance.
- Legal Aid: Resources may be available to help with legal representation and advice at little or no cost.

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is crucial for anyone experiencing domestic violence. A safety plan includes steps you can take to protect yourself and your children, if applicable. Consider packing an emergency bag, identifying safe places to go, and establishing a code word with trusted friends or family members to signal for help.
